The Water Show

A fun and education play about the world's most precious resource.

Director: Chris John

Cast: Peter Cortissos, Ezra Juanta

It is the year 2110 and the world's water supply is in crisis. The earth is still in recovery from the Great Water Wars of the late 21st century.

In a bid to avert a global catastrophe, agents Smith and Jones are sent back in time 100 years to collect as much information about water as they can.

Using the high tech gadgetry in their time-space module, Smith and Jones discover a wide range of information about water, including Archimede's Principle, the hydrological process, ocean life, water in popular culture and typical water use by suburban families.

The Water Show is presented by Splash Theatre Company.
